How To Replace Panic Button Battery. The Panic Button takes a single CR-2032 Lithium 3V battery and has a life expectancy of up to 5 years depending on placement and usage.To change your Panic Button battery, remove it from its bracket and replace the lithium battery. Then, put the device back on its bracket.The Simplisafe keyfob is 2nd gen and can only be used with Simplisafe3. There is a small red button on the top of the keyfob to prevent accidental triggarage. Q: Can two of these pair to ...To install a new SimpliSafe Key Fob, or to reinstall one that was removed, follow the instructions below. Using your SimpliSafe Keypad, press Menu and enter your Master PIN. Open Devices. Select Add Device. Scroll down to Key Fob and click Add. Press and hold the red panic button on top of your Key Fob for two seconds, then release. ….
